AHS golf team wins W Covina tourney

The Arcadia High School Apaches boys golf team won the West Covina High School Tournament at South Hills CC for the second year in a row, shooting a team total 375. Additionally, Yale-bound Jonathan Lai shot a three-under par 69 to win Low Medalist honors, and Sophomore Kevin Chen shot an even-par 72.
